Xingli Ma is a scholar working on Plant Science, Molecular Biology and Inorganic Chemistry. According to data from OpenAlex, Xingli Ma has authored 30 papers receiving a total of 516 ind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Plant Science, 12 papers in Molecular Biology and 5 papers in Inorganic Chemistry. Recurrent topics in Xingli Ma’s work include Peanut Plant Research Studies (17 papers), Nitrogen and Sulfur Effects on Brassica (7 papers) and Agricultural pest management studies (5 papers). Xingli Ma is often cited by papers focused on Peanut Plant Research Studies (17 papers), Nitrogen and Sulfur Effects on Brassica (7 papers) and Agricultural pest management studies (5 papers). Xingli Ma collaborates with scholars based in China, United States and Australia. Xingli Ma's co-authors include Dongmei Yin, Xing‐Guo Zhang, Kunkun Zhao, Xiaoyan He, Yun Wang, Zhong‐Feng Li, Zeyu Xin, Liru Cao, Qinghua Yang and Zhiqiang Wang and has published in prestigious journals such as Nature Genetics, Journal of Agricultural and Food Chemistry and Scientific Reports.
